Transaction 33a66e94fd3640bbc2decf875b19316691a6d5861e79d06b813d2d4452eb8a11

1 Input
2 Outputs
  • 33a66e94fd3640bbc2decf875b19316691a6d5861e79d06b813d2d4452eb8a11:0
  • value  196150000
    address  1Q2Du71Y74JVdgM1jp2UKAeYweiycJRmCT
  • 33a66e94fd3640bbc2decf875b19316691a6d5861e79d06b813d2d4452eb8a11:1
  • value  669501391
    address  17XiDqzEtwENxFxVFGhTioCHAXsARjqzB3